The traditional Indian greeting is all set to gain popularity thanks to the coronavirus scare.
The Mumbai police have decided to implement the mode of greeting instead of shaking hands every time visitors come to the police station. The commissioner's office has recently issued a circular to all police stations to welcome people with a namaste instead of handshakes.
